Postoperative leakages occur in 3% to 15% of cases and are considered serious complications. They are responsible for one-third of postoperative deaths in patients. Surgical sealants and adhesives are designed to improve patient outcomes by reducing the prospect of postsurgical complications, such as leakages, thus resulting in improved patient outcomes through the prevention of leakage and a decrease in length of stay and mortality rates.
Gain deeper insights on the market and receive your free copy with TOC now @: Surgical Sealants And Adhesives Market Report
The rapid advancements in sealants and adhesives are major impact rendering drivers, and their usage in modern surgery to reduce anastomotic leakage has risen significantly. Surgical adhesive is expected to replace traditional surgical sealing agents such as sutures, wires, and staples. These are time taking, can result in further tissue trauma, and are hard to use in some surgical locations. Surgical sealants overcome these issues and create immediate and proper sealing, compared to sutures and staples. Adsorption is the accumulation of atoms or molecules on the surface of a material. This process creates a film of the adsorbate on the adsorbent’s surface. Adsorbents are used to remove pollutants from oil and gas streams in the oil and gas sector and are also increasingly being used in the gas drying process. The zeolites segment held the largest share in the Adsorbents Market in 2023. Zeolites have a high degree of hydration, which results in a stable low-density crystal structure with a large void volume. Zeolites have been employed as an adsorbent in non-technically demanding, non-regenerative applications over the past two decades. New lightweight cementing methods for oil and gas completions to new modified zeolite adsorbents for extracting metals or organics from water are just a few of the new inventive applications. Systems for zeolite gas treatment, pressure swing adsorption, smell control, and other specific applications are being developed. Inorganic adsorbents, particularly for environmental applications, industrial gas production, and specialized chemicals, are the most valuable applications for zeolites and synthesized zeolites. Adsorbents are utilized in the petrochemical industry to remove trace contaminants such as water and sulphur in the feed, intermediate, and product streams, for the smooth operation of the plant. The usage of the right adsorbent is necessary for the petrochemical plants due to the reactivity of ethylene plant streams. In the petrochemical industry, adsorbents are used for the effective removal of a wide range of contaminants from olefin-containing streams, complete system solutions for the treatment of off-gas streams from catalytic crackers (FCC, DCC, CPP) and acetylene producing units, and long lifetime and easy operability. Pharmaceutical companies are putting a greater emphasis on quality control, which includes the use of adsorbents in procedures like instrument drying, drying of air-synthesis products, and deodorization. Several types of adsorbents are utilized in the pharmaceutical sector, with a selection depending on the application requirement. Activated carbon, for instance, is used to remove contaminated or by-products during the drug formulation process, whereas activated alumina is used to recover Pyrogen-free pharmaceuticals and as a desiccant for drying air and industrial gases. Also, silica gel is also employed in column chromatography as a pharmaceutical adsorbent, where it assists in the separation or collection of various medication components. Reduced Shelf Life Due to High Level of Impurities Will Hamper the Market Growth
Although adsorbent materials can attract molecules to their surfaces, this ability is limited. Once the capacity has been reached, continued refining and purification will produce an equilibrium, which will lead to desorption. Adsorbents are utilized for adsorption of various pollutants and impurities such as carbon dioxide or hydrogen sulphide, mercaptans, manufacturing chemicals, and hydrate inhibitors in refining and purifying processes. The current contaminants react with the adsorbents at this point, causing the adsorbent to regenerate. These pollutants either renew or eliminate the adsorbent. The service life of adsorbents is determined by the material’s regeneration capacity, which could be a stumbling block for the overall adsorbents market.

Adhesives and sealants are the chemical products which are used to create a mechanical seal between components. Adhesives are the non-metallic materials used to hold two substances together, while sealants are material used to fill space between these substances and to provide a protective coating. Adhesives are of various types like polyurethane adhesives, cyanoacrylate adhesive and epoxy adhesives, while sealants consist of resin like silicon, acrylic and butyl. These materials are chemically made with the help of rheology modifiers which are used to improve their viscosity. Adhesives and sealants have high applicability in sectors like construction, automotive, paper, textile, electronics and wood. What Are Aliphatic Polyester Polyols?
Aliphatic polyester polyols are a class of polyols used primarily in the production of polyurethanes. These compounds are derived from aliphatic diols and dicarboxylic acids, making them more stable and resistant to UV degradation compared to their aromatic counterparts. Their unique chemical structure allows them to offer excellent mechanical properties, flexibility, and chemical resistance.

Isobutyl acrylate is an ester of acrylic acid and isobutanol. It is prized for its role in enhancing the properties of polymers, such as flexibility, durability, and adhesion. UV Stabilizers Market Segment Analysis — By Type
The hindered amine light stabilizers (HALS) segment held the largest share in the UV stabilizer market in 2023, as it efficiently inhibits polymer degradation. HALS high efficiency and longevity are due to a cyclic process wherein the HALS are regenerated rather than consumed during the stabilization process. Hindered amine light stabilizers are very efficient stabilizers for polymers and especially polyolefins. They do not absorb UV radiation but act to inhibit degradation of the polymer. In addition, significant levels of stabilization are achieved at relatively low concentrations on using hindered amine light stabilizers due to which its demand is increasing from various end-use industries. Polymer photo degradation occurs when a substance is exposed to UV radiation and the physical characteristics of the substance, such as colour, loss of material strength, elongation and tensile strength characteristics or surface cracking, are deteriorated. The manufacturers therefore apply UV light stabilizers to prevent damage and avoid loss of components that are exposed to UV radiation.
